HC Deb 17 January 1967 vol 739 c29W
Mr. McNamara

asked the President of the Board of Trade what regulations cover the fencing of dangerous machinery and fishing gear and the height of bulwarks on British trawlers.

Mr. J. P. W. Mallalieu

The existing regulations do not cover these matters, but the United Kingdom will be playing a full part in the comprehensive examination of all aspects of the safety of fishing vessels which is now being undertaken by the international organisations concerned (I.M.C.O., I.L.O. and F.A.O.).
